Which of the following statements is true about the equilibrium constant? (2019)
Step 1: Understand what the equilibrium constant (Kc) is. It is a number that tells us the ratio of the concentrations of products to reactants at equilibrium in a chemical reaction.
Step 2: Recognize that Kc is not a fixed number; it can change. This change happens when the temperature of the reaction changes.
Step 3: Remember that for a specific reaction at a specific temperature, Kc will remain constant. This means if you measure Kc at 25 degrees Celsius, it will be the same every time you measure it at that temperature.
Step 4: Conclude that the statement about Kc being temperature-dependent is true, as it changes with temperature but is constant for a given reaction at a specific temperature.
